Ven. Rev. Amos Tweteise was installed as the new archdeacon for Kikungiri.

By Sophan Niwamanya

apearlnews.com

It was glamour, songs of joy, and praise as Christians of St Mark’s Kikungiri Church of Uganda Archdeaconry witnessed the installation of Ven. Rev. Amos Tweteise today, Thursday, April 13, 2023.

The installation ceremony was presided over by the Bishop of the Diocese of Kigezi, Rt Rev Gaddie Akanjuna, assisted by archdeacons and other priests at St. Mark Kikungiri Archdeaconry headquarters located in Southern Division, Kabale Municipality, Kabale district.

While preaching, Bishop Akanjuna has asked the new Archdeacon, Ven. Rev. Amos Tweteise, to always trust God, to humble himself before Christians, to avoid being greedy and proud, and to only be a good example to other people as a leader. Bishop also appealed to parents to always create time for their children and know their responsibilities.

Bishop Akanjuna handed over the Bible, Church of Uganda Constitution, canons, and Diocese of Kigezi Constitution to Archdeacon Tweteise and gave him the go-ahead to serve St. Mark’s Kikungiri Archdeaconry Christians officially.
